Day 04
Thimphu - Punakha
- After breakfast, drive to Punakha, the former capital of Bhutan.
- En route, visit the Dochula Pass and enjoy stunning views of the Himalayas.
- Visit Punakha Dzong, located at the confluence of the Pho Chhu and Mo Chhu rivers.
- Explore Chimi Lhakhang, the Temple of Fertility, famously known as the “Divine Madman’s Temple.”
- Dinner and overnight stay in Punakha.
